ขอสอบถามเกี่ยวกับการแก้ Code ของ VBA ที่วน Loop ไม่รู้จบ
Posted: Thu Mar 27, 2014 2:31 pm
สวัสดีค่ะ อาจารย์
หนูเป็นนักศึกษาปริญญาโท ตอนนี้กำลังทำวิทยานิพนธ์เกี่ยวกับฮิวริสติกในการมอบหมายงานคนขับรถ โดยที่อาจารย์ที่ปรึกษาให้เขียน VBA เพื่อหาคำตอบ แต่หนูไม่ค่อยมีพื้นฐานในการเขียนโปรแกรมเท่าไหร่นัก (ตอนนี้ก็กำลังศึกษาโดยการอ่านหนังสือเพิ่มเติมอยู่ค่ะ) ซึ่งทำให้งานเดินได้ช้ามาก
โจทย์คือ หนูจะต้องมอบหมายงาน 20 งาน ที่มีระยะทางต่างกัน ให้กับพนักงานขับรถ 5 คน โดยที่พนักงานแต่ละคนต้องได้ระยะทางที่ใกล้เคียงกันมากที่สุด ซึ่งวิธีการในการแก้ไขปัญหาที่หนูคิดคือ หนูจะมอบหมายงานที่มีระยะทางมากที่สุดให้พนักงานขับรถแต่ละคนจนครบ 5 คน จากนั้นหนูจะดูว่าพนักงานคนไหนที่ได้ระยะทางสะสมน้อยที่สุดก็จะมอบหมายงานที่มีระยะทางสูงสุดที่เหลืออยู่ และทำจนครบทุกงาน (งานนี้เป็นเพียงส่วนหนึ่งของวิทยานิพนธ์)
ตอนนี้งานที่หนูกำลังเริ่มเขียน code ติดปัญหาในการเขียน code โดยหนูได้แนบไฟล์มาด้วยค่ะ คือว่า เหมือน code ที่เขียนขึ้นมันวน loop ไม่รู้จบ ตอนนี้หนูจะขอความกรุณาจากอาจารย์ช่วยแนะนำในการแก้ปัญหาดังกล่าว
ขอบพระคุณที่อาจารย์เสียสละเวลาในการตอบคำถามค่ะ
หนูเป็นนักศึกษาปริญญาโท ตอนนี้กำลังทำวิทยานิพนธ์เกี่ยวกับฮิวริสติกในการมอบหมายงานคนขับรถ โดยที่อาจารย์ที่ปรึกษาให้เขียน VBA เพื่อหาคำตอบ แต่หนูไม่ค่อยมีพื้นฐานในการเขียนโปรแกรมเท่าไหร่นัก (ตอนนี้ก็กำลังศึกษาโดยการอ่านหนังสือเพิ่มเติมอยู่ค่ะ) ซึ่งทำให้งานเดินได้ช้ามาก
โจทย์คือ หนูจะต้องมอบหมายงาน 20 งาน ที่มีระยะทางต่างกัน ให้กับพนักงานขับรถ 5 คน โดยที่พนักงานแต่ละคนต้องได้ระยะทางที่ใกล้เคียงกันมากที่สุด ซึ่งวิธีการในการแก้ไขปัญหาที่หนูคิดคือ หนูจะมอบหมายงานที่มีระยะทางมากที่สุดให้พนักงานขับรถแต่ละคนจนครบ 5 คน จากนั้นหนูจะดูว่าพนักงานคนไหนที่ได้ระยะทางสะสมน้อยที่สุดก็จะมอบหมายงานที่มีระยะทางสูงสุดที่เหลืออยู่ และทำจนครบทุกงาน (งานนี้เป็นเพียงส่วนหนึ่งของวิทยานิพนธ์)
ตอนนี้งานที่หนูกำลังเริ่มเขียน code ติดปัญหาในการเขียน code โดยหนูได้แนบไฟล์มาด้วยค่ะ คือว่า เหมือน code ที่เขียนขึ้นมันวน loop ไม่รู้จบ ตอนนี้หนูจะขอความกรุณาจากอาจารย์ช่วยแนะนำในการแก้ปัญหาดังกล่าว
ขอบพระคุณที่อาจารย์เสียสละเวลาในการตอบคำถามค่ะ